letting the mind of Christ saturate our mind and living in the index of the Lord’s eyes

July 23, 2011 by aGodMan Leave a Comment

letting the mind of Christ saturate our mind and living in the index of the Lord's eyes [picture credit: Giorgio Trovato, Look me in the eye]“Let this mind be in you, which was also in Christ Jesus…” (Phil. 2:5) – Christ had a certain frame of mind, a mind of His own, and this mind needs to become our mind.

As believers in Christ, we have Christ in our spirit as the indwelling Christ living in us – but we need to allow Christ to spread from our spirit into every part of our soul! The leading part of our soul is our mind, so we need to take Christ’s mind as our mind.

This is why Paul says in Rom. 12:2 that we need to be transformed by the renewing of our mind – our mind is being slowly filled and replaced with the mind of Christ.

Just as a hand enters into the glove to give meaning, purpose, and sense to the glove, so Christ’s mind enters into our mind to give meaning, purpose, and sense to our mind! Practically, we need to cooperate with the Lord by opening to Him and praying to Him,

Lord, I want to take You as my life and my person! May Your mind become my mind. I even want to reject my own mind and allow You to spread into my mind and fill my mind with Your thinking, Your thoughts…

Too many times Christ is “imprisoned in our spirit” and we don’t allow Him into our mind. Our mind is so busy and occupied with the things related to our family life, our job, our personal life, our business, our property, etc – but Christ is longing and waiting for us to turn again to Him and allow Him to saturate, invade, permeate, and take over our mind!

When we open to Him and take Him as our person, we will let the mind of Christ be our mind and we will consider everything that is related to us according to the mind of Christ.

Another matter that impressed me this morning concerning the indwelling Christ – who is so enjoyable and experiential – was Paul’s experience of forgiving the brother in Corinth “for your sake in the person of Christ” (2 Cor. 2:10).

Paul didn’t just say simply, I forgave the brother – let’s get it over with. No, he forgave the brother and he did everything in the person of Christ – and particularly here the person refers to the index of a person’s eyes, where you can see clearly how he feels, how he thinks, etc.

He allowed the mind of Christ to become his mind to such an extent that everything he did was in the person of Christ, in the index of the Lord’s eyes, one with the Lord.

This living Person in us, the indwelling Christ, wants to become so real and personal to us that we do everything in oneness with Him, by looking into the Lord’s eyes and being one with Him… I was particularly helped and encouraged by this precious quote from the Life-Study of 2 Corinthians (msg 4),

Thus, he writes this Epistle to comfort and encourage them in a very personal, tender, and affectionate way, so much so that this Epistle may be considered to some extent his autobiography. In it we see a person who lives Christ, according to what he wrote concerning Him in his first Epistle, in the closest and most intimate contact with Him, acting according to the index of His eyes; a person who is one with Christ, full of Christ, and is saturated with Christ; one who is broken and even terminated in his natural life, softened and flexible in his will, affectionate yet restricted in his emotion, considerate and sober in his mind, and pure and genuine in his spirit toward the believers for their benefit, that they may experience and enjoy Christ as he does for the fulfillment of God’s eternal purpose in the building up of Christ’s Body.
